Longest I ever went was when me and a friend had a levelling challenge on WoW, levelling alts from 1-whatever until we fell asleep. I locked myself in my room for it, came out only for toilet breaks.

He fell asleep at around the 54 hour mark... but I had a secret weapon, this drink called Star Cola (now taken off the shelves in England due to EXCESSIVE sugar and E numbers) which is literally better than energy drinks. Sugar rush galore.

The last time I remember checking the time I was at 69 hours... and then I remember waking up about 14 hours later in my bed.

Longest I've stayed up in my life is only 3 hours more than that, and that was New Year's 2002/2003. I don't recommend it, after about 30 hours you start experiencing what's called micro-sleep, where you literally almost go on standby for a second, 'waking up' after a few seconds of inactivity.

After about 50 hours you make NO sense and are literally focused so much on what you're doing that the time starts to slip by.

After the 60 mark I got really grumpy and agitated easily, however this KINDA helped stay up since it got my adrenaline running a bit.

70 hours is pass-out stage. Any time after this, your body can literally just decide it's had anough and shut down.
